Bitcoin’s slow and gradual price revival took it to $65,000 for the first time since Friday a few hours ago, but the asset still has yet to overcome that level for good.
Most larger-cap alts have produced minor moves as well over the past 24 hours, with ETH climbing above $1,900, while XRP continues to underperform.
